How Naturally Treating Eczema Can Help You Ease The Uncomfortableness

Naturally treating eczema can serve in removing or easing the symptoms associated with eczema, and it may also mean using topical as well as oral medication that are known to thin out the rashes as well as not allowing new flare-ups which is something that naturally treating eczema must shoot for for. And, if your eczema problem is peculiarly severe, you may even want to fuse both oral and topical medications.

No question, the numbers of eczema conditions are many, and eczema in whichever form it occurs, will not touch two people in the same way which means acquiring technical medical advice regarding the right way to naturally treating eczema. To start with, you may choose creams, lotions, ointments as well as bath oils and even emollients as your favorite way of naturally treating eczema. In fact, you will be well advised to use moisturizers whatsoever is the type of eczema that is bothering you since they are known to cause rehydration of dry as well as chapped parts of the body, and among different products to choose from, you could consider using Eucerin, Aquaphor as well as Moisturel and even mineral and baby oils.

Some other one of the green ways of naturally treating eczema you may like to consider for your eczema problem is using topical steroids that can be used along with moisturizers particularly when you observe symptoms of eczema not improving and your affected parts of the body keep on to remain very irritated as well as swollen. You can choose topical steroids that are of low potency and even those that have high potency and which type you use will depend on how severe your eczema condition is.

There is also some other way to naturally treating eczema in that you may care to use topical immunosuppressant of which Protopic and Elidel are good examples that are peculiarly efficient when it comes to treating eczema and which work through being able to control the reactions of the immune system against irritants and triggers and thereby helps to clear up the affected part of the body and gives ease as well. This eczema treatment should however, is used only as a last resort.

There are other ways of naturally treating eczema that also includes using orally antihistamines that will bring down itchiness, using oral steroids which is very in force when other treatments fail to do the job, trying out phototherapy as some other last resort eczema treatment, and in the end, using antibiotics on affected and inflamed parts of the body, though this eczema treatment must be taken only after having been advised by a doctor.
